Output 013a359b406f956554369bd6e85f8a3933a60a967f43a9695bf2a32f7e663e3b:23

value
84735
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c96ca8b79ea4a70baa288aeba0d517db7c99d29a OP_EQUAL
address
3L43us7vhXqoaDDAj3CuaGEXbifn3ywsNN
transaction
013a359b406f956554369bd6e85f8a3933a60a967f43a9695bf2a32f7e663e3b
confirmations
153238
spent
true